WebOrbital cellulitis, or postseptal cellulitis, is a more dangerous infection that can infiltrate the intraconal structures, including the optic nerve and sheath, and can lead to vascular complications as well. Visual loss, ophthalmoplegia, pain on eye movement, and proptosis may be clinical indications of orbital cellulitis, whereas periorbital ...

RCHT Pathology have some capacity to answer queries via email. Intended for requesting add on tests to specimens already sent to the labs, copy reports or general queries about specimens/containers etc. Both email accounts are checked 5 or 6 times a day, with an immediate or next day response wherever possible. how to restore gst registrationWebdoclibrary-rcht.cornwall.nhs.uk how to restore google account after deleting
